Summary

A missing child's body is found on the edge of the Peak District. As DCI Kenny Murrain and his team investigate, more attempted child abductions are reported. Murrain's instincts tell him this is a community with secrets, and those secrets have their roots deep in the past.  

Unexpected connections surface as he uncovers mysteries long buried. A motorcycle accident in the nearby hills. The unexplained death of a local prison governor. And a high-profile child killing two decades before. Then another child goes missing, and Murrain and his team must race to identify the killer before the past catches up with them and it's too late....
